    My frog started to get agitated in a long tank he needed the height and started croaking and rubbing his nose on the screen trying to climb higher. as soon as i got an 18x18x24 he went wild climbing every where and on the branches he was so excited the nose rubbing and croaking stopped now he is back to normal.
